JUCE  v5.4.1-191-g0ab5e696f
JUCE API
Looking for a senior C++ dev?
I'm looking for work. Hire me!
CameraDevice::Pimpl::CaptureSession::VideoRecorder::FileOutputRecordingDelegateClass Struct Reference
Inheritance diagram for CameraDevice::Pimpl::CaptureSession::VideoRecorder::FileOutputRecordingDelegateClass:
Collaboration diagram for CameraDevice::Pimpl::CaptureSession::VideoRecorder::FileOutputRecordingDelegateClass:

Public Member Functions

 FileOutputRecordingDelegateClass ()
 

Static Public Member Functions

static VideoRecordergetOwner (id self)
 
static void setOwner (id self, VideoRecorder *r)
 

Static Private Member Functions

static void started (id self, SEL, AVCaptureFileOutput *, NSURL *, NSArray< AVCaptureConnection *> *)
 
static void stopped (id self, SEL, AVCaptureFileOutput *, NSURL *, NSArray< AVCaptureConnection *> *, NSError *error)
 

Constructor & Destructor Documentation

◆ FileOutputRecordingDelegateClass()

CameraDevice::Pimpl::CaptureSession::VideoRecorder::FileOutputRecordingDelegateClass::FileOutputRecordingDelegateClass ( )
inline

Member Function Documentation

◆ getOwner()

static VideoRecorder& CameraDevice::Pimpl::CaptureSession::VideoRecorder::FileOutputRecordingDelegateClass::getOwner ( id  self)
inlinestatic

◆ setOwner()

static void CameraDevice::Pimpl::CaptureSession::VideoRecorder::FileOutputRecordingDelegateClass::setOwner ( id  self,
VideoRecorder r 
)
inlinestatic

◆ started()

static void CameraDevice::Pimpl::CaptureSession::VideoRecorder::FileOutputRecordingDelegateClass::started ( id  self,
SEL  ,
AVCaptureFileOutput *  ,
NSURL *  ,
NSArray< AVCaptureConnection *> *   
)
inlinestaticprivate

◆ stopped()

static void CameraDevice::Pimpl::CaptureSession::VideoRecorder::FileOutputRecordingDelegateClass::stopped ( id  self,
SEL  ,
AVCaptureFileOutput *  ,
NSURL *  ,
NSArray< AVCaptureConnection *> *  ,
NSError *  error 
)
inlinestaticprivate

The documentation for this struct was generated from the following file: